WebApr 1, 2024 · Public housing for felons is possible, depending on the felony offense. However, certain convictions can disqualify applicants. There are two types of felony … WebHousing and Housing Choice Voucher programs? The U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) explicitly requires two bans based on criminal activity. HUD requires that all Public Housing Authorities (PHAs) establish lifetime bans on the admission to the Public Housing and Housing Choice Voucher (Tenant-Based Section 8) … oracle bsd
